Trezor is a hardware wallet that allows users to store their cryptocurrency safely offline. Unlike online wallets or exchanges, Trezor provides enhanced protection against hacking, phishing, and malware by keeping your private keys in a physical device. With the rise of cyber threats, a hardware wallet like Trezor is crucial for long-term crypto investors and traders who want to ensure that their assets remain secure.

Step 2: Unbox Your Trezor Device
Once you've received your Trezor hardware wallet, unbox it carefully. Inside, you should find the following items:
The Trezor device itself
A USB cable
A recovery seed card
A quick-start guide
The recovery seed card is crucial. This 24-word phrase is the key to recovering your funds in case you lose your device or it gets damaged. Never share this phrase with anyone or store it online.
Step 3: Connect Your Trezor to Your Computer
To begin the setup process, connect your Trezor device to your computer using the included USB cable. Ensure you are on a secure, trusted device to prevent any potential threats to your security.
Once connected, your Trezor device will prompt you to visit the website Trezor.io/Start to begin the setup.
Step 4: Install Trezor Bridge or Trezor Suite
Next, the website will instruct you to install Trezor Bridge or the Trezor Suite app. Trezor Bridge is a lightweight piece of software that facilitates communication between your Trezor device and your computer.
Alternatively, Trezor Suite is a more comprehensive application that not only allows you to set up and manage your Trezor device but also offers additional features like portfolio management, transaction tracking, and more. For a more robust experience, we recommend installing Trezor Suite.
Step 5: Create a New Wallet or Restore an Existing One
Now, it’s time to create a new wallet. If this is your first time setting up a Trezor device, you’ll need to select the “Create a new wallet” option.
If you're restoring an existing wallet from a previous Trezor device, you’ll choose the “Recover Wallet” option and enter the 24-word recovery phrase.
For new users, creating a wallet involves generating a new recovery seed. The website will display a series of 24 words; write these down in the exact order on the recovery card provided with your device. Do not store your recovery seed online. Keep it in a safe, offline location.
Step 6: Set Up a PIN for Added Security
To enhance the security of your wallet, you’ll need to set up a PIN. This PIN will be required whenever you access your Trezor device. Choose a unique and secure PIN, ensuring that it isn’t easily guessable. The device will prompt you to enter your PIN multiple times to confirm it.
Step 7: Confirm Your Recovery Seed
After setting up your PIN, Trezor will ask you to confirm the 24-word recovery seed you wrote down earlier. This step ensures you have correctly noted the recovery phrase, which is critical for restoring access to your wallet if you ever lose your Trezor device.

Tips for Using Your Trezor Wallet Safely
Never Share Your Recovery Seed: The recovery seed is the key to your wallet. If someone else gains access to it, they can access your funds.
Use a Strong PIN: Your PIN is a critical layer of protection. Choose a strong, hard-to-guess PIN.
Back Up Your Recovery Seed: Write your recovery seed down on paper and store it in a safe place. Consider storing it in multiple secure locations for added protection.
Stay Vigilant Against Phishing: Always ensure you are on the official Trezor website and never enter your recovery seed or private keys on any site other than the official Trezor platform.
